THERE are 11 categories that local organisations can enter in this year’s Pride of Tameside Business Awards.
Nominations are now open for the return of the anticipated awards ceremony on Friday, June 13, at Dukinfield Town Hall.
The awards – organised by Tameside Council – made a successful return last year following a five-year absence.
The not-for-profit awards aim to celebrate the outstanding individuals and businesses that drive the local economy and strengthen Tameside’s community.
A number of local businesses have sponsored the event and categories – including GM Business Growth Hub, Visual Architects, Brand Twelve Digital Agency, Red Rock, Bromleys Solicitors, Tameside College, Bennett Staff, Auxilium Services, AC Group, and RSK Group.

The categories that businesses can enter in are as follows:
Large Employer of the Year (51+ employees)
Entrepreneur of the Year
Creative Business of the Year
Manufacturing / Engineering Business of the Year
Construction / Property Business of the Year
Childcare / Social Care Business of the Year
Tech / Digital Business of the Year
Social Enterprise / CIC / Charity of the Year
Green Impact Business of the Year
SME of the Year (2 – 50 employees)
Retail, Hospitality and eCommerce Business of the Year
